I need to download OS X El Capitan 10.11 but I can't find it--

I already downloaded OS X El Capitan 10.11.6 but it won't work and says I need OS X El Capitan 10.11 first.

Sounds like you tried to install an update to El Capitan, for which you would need a previous version of El Capitan installed. You need to download the full El Capitan installer which is approximately 6Gbs, and can be found here,

How to download OS X El Capitan - Apple Support

Depending on your Mac model and its age i.e. if your Mac can upgrade to High Sierra then the App Store will reject your request to download El Capitan as Apple wants you to have the latest software.

if it is definitely El Capitan you want then you may need to find a Mac/ friend that can only upgrade to El Capitan to download it and move it to yours and then install it. Please check back if it is the case...

However, the whole process was very painful but I continued my quest regardless. Here is how I achieved my goal in the end:-


I have successfully installed EL Capitan OS X 10.11.6 and it was not easy, I made a decision after all the problems I had, and that was to install my original SO X from 2009 and take it through to Leopard and the Snow Leopard Up-Grades but, stopped at reinstalling Yosemite. I then hunted to find this Link: https://support.apple.com/en-gb/HT206886 in which I found the path to downloading and installing El Capitan. I did download it but did not install as I wanted to make a bootable SD Stick, this I have now done and have finally made a clean install of El Capitan on my 2009 Macbook Pro 17"


Here is a Copy of my Terminal.app Log and how it worked:-


After Installation:


Last login: Sun Apr 8 17:57:59 on ttys000

john-shearers-macbook-pro:~ shearerjo$ sudo /Applications/Install\ OS\ X\ El\ Capitan.app/Contents/Resources/createinstallmedia --volume /Volumes/Untitled --applicationpath /Applications/Install\ OS\ X\ El\ Capitan.app --nointeraction

Password:

Erasing Disk: 0%... 10%... 20%... 30%...100%...

Copying installer files to disk...

Copy complete.

Making disk bootable...

Copying boot files...

Copy complete.

Done.

john-shearers-macbook-pro:~ shearerjo$

I then erased my hard drive restarted my Mac and held down the alt key when you hear the start-up chimes, continue to hold till the window came up to asking which disk you want to install from..... Select the Install Sd Stick and proceed. sit back or get a jug of Coffee as it may take awhile


I hope this will help you or anyone really interested in up-grading to El Capitan and having the same frustration I went through.
